Binahong (Basella rubra L.) is a plant medicine consisting secondary metabolites which have virtue asmedicines for several diseases that could also be used as coloring agent. The medicine compounds in secondarymetabolites could be extracted from callus. Sucrose is one of the components that build MS (Murashige & Skoog)medium. Sucrose is important in in vitro culture, it functions as carbon and energy source for explant to grow. Thepurposes of this research are to study the effect of sucrose in MS medium towards B. rubra L callus formation andgrowth; to find the optimum sucrose concentration for callus B. rubra L formation; and also to find the fastestinitiation time to produce callus crumb. This research uses Complete Random Design (CRD) single factor method,i.e., sucrose concentration of 0 g/l, 10g/l, 20 g/l, 30 g/l, 40 g/l with five repetitions. The data is analysed withAnalysis of Varian (Anova) and if a real difference is found the analysis is continued with Duncan Multiple RangeTest (DMRT) with significancy level of 95%. The results show that various sucrose concentrations in MS mediuminfluences callus B. rubra L induction. The highest sucrose concentration, i.e. 40 g/l, which was added into MSmedium, could induce the maximum callus wet-weight of 1,69 g and the fastest callus initiation time of 4,8 day.
